Harmony Remote Provides the Hottest Remote Control for this Years Grammy Stars

Annual goodie bag for performers and presenters includes hottest new universal remote that controls even the most ambitious A/V systems

Mississauga, Ontario, Feb. 13, 2004 — Intrigue Technologies Inc., a leader in intelligent remote control technology, provided their most popular controller, the Model-659 Family Remote for the gift baskets given out at the 46th Annual Grammy Awards to all presenters and performers.

“We were extremely pleased to participate in this year’s Grammy Awards by contributing our most successful product, the Model-659 Family Remote,” says Geoff Lyon, the VP of Sales and Marketing for the Harmony Remote. “What makes the Harmony Remote so popular is anyone can use it, not just gadget gurus.”

Among the recipients of the gift basket were Justin Timberlake, Christina Aquilera, Celine Dion, Ellen DeGeneres, Beyonce, Sting, Outkast, and Madonna. “They may be celebrities,” adds Lyon, “But they still need a simple solution for controlling their home entertainment center just like everyone else. ”

Receiving overwhelming critical acclaim and recognition from consumers and the press, the success of the groundbreaking Harmony Family Remote is attributed to their unique and revolutionary, Smart State Technology. Due to Activity-based programming, at a glance, the easy to identify buttons marked “Watch TV”, Watch A DVD” or “Listen to Music” makes using the Harmony Remote easier than the remotes that actually come with the original electronic components. It is the only universal remote that is custom configured over the Internet and is both PC and Mac compatible.

“With seemingly impossible-to-impress celebrities, only the most unique and ground-breaking technology and products are acceptable,” says Johnny Ward, President of Distinctive Assets, the company who selects products for each year’s Grammy gift basket. ” The amazing Harmony Remote has not only exceeded the expectations of Distinctive Assets’ high-profile clientele, but has also raised the bar for ingenuity within the entire home entertainment industry.”

Harmony Remotes can be found at select A/V retailers and all Best Buy superstores. For more information or images of the Harmony Remote Model-659 contact Kim Wilson [818 843 5555].

About Intrigue Technologies Inc. and The Harmony Remote
Justin Henry and Glen Harris, two biomedical engineers, originally founded Intrigue Technologies Inc. in 1999. They were frustrated by the complexity of operating a “simple” home theatre system and the plethora of remote control devices that were required. After identifying the opportunity for a “web-connected” universal remote control, they spent two years developing the Harmony Remote Control, establishing the company that is now known as Intrigue Technologies Inc. The company’s vision is to produce revolutionary products that help consumers simplify their every day lives. For more information on Harmony Remote’s full product line visit www.HarmonyRemote.com.
